Course Content

• Introduction to General Relativity and Black Holes
• Gravitational Waves: Detection and Analysis
• Black Hole Thermodynamics and Information Paradox
• Accretion Disks and Active Galactic Nuclei
• Numerical Relativity and Black Hole Simulations
• Astrophysics of Black Holes: Observations and Modelling
• Gravitational Wave Astronomy and Multi-messenger Astrophysics
• Advanced Topics in Black Hole Physics (e.g., Kerr Black Holes)
